Stevie Ray Vaughan and Double Trouble: Live at Montreux 1985 (1985)
Stevie Ray Vaughan and Double Trouble: Live at Montreux July 15, 1985. Three years after his first Montreux performance, when Stevie was invited back to headline "Blues Night" at the festival, the crowd, now familiar with Stevie's songs and albums treated him like the conquering hero. Stevie again played like his life depended on it because as we all came to recognize and respect that was the only way he knew how.
Runtime: 94 min
Release Date: July 15, 1985
